Recent advances in digital signal processing and semiconductor technology have changed the architecture and capabilities of traditional radar designs. Now, new developments in time and frequency distribution across networks, the miniaturization of atomic clocks, and advances in Inertial Measurement Units (IMUs) brings the next wave of innovation. 

This presentation will describe these latest trends in Position, Navigation and Time (PNT) synchronization and how they apply to the radar and command and control applications. Picosecond level synchronization over network interfaces is now possible, revolutionizing the phased array antenna. “White Rabbit” technology, which can provide sub-nanosecond time synchronization and frequency syntonization over Ethernet networks, is changing the architecture of phased array antennas – providing a single connection for both clock sync and high-speed data. Precise network sync is also important on command and control networks as radars and weapon systems exchange precise position and navigation coordinates in real-time. For positioning and alignment of radars, the latest in Micro Electro-Mechanical Systems (MEMS) and Hemispherical Resonating Gyros (HRGs) are enabling accurate azimuth gyrocompass alignment in minutes. Low phase noise ultra-stable oscillators are capable of operation in rugged environments.

For almost 20 years, John Fischer has been working with global navigation satellite systems (GNSS), wireless, positioning, navigation and timing (PNT) and specialized systems for our customers at Orolia, now part of Safran Navigation & Timing. Prior to joining Orolia, he specialized in wireless telecom as a founding member of two startups: Aria Wireless in 1990 and Clearwire Technologies in 1997. At Clearwire, he served as Chief Technology Officer in creating wireless broadband equipment for Internet connectivity. Early in his career, John worked as a systems engineer in radar, EW and command and control systems. He graduated with a Masters and Bachelors of Science in Electrical Engineering and Computing Engineering from the State University of New York at Buffalo.
